Morbidity and mortality of necrotizing fasciitis and their prognostic factors in children
Conclusions: Pediatric NF has significant morbidity and mortality. Patients with adverse prognostic factors can benefit from early referral to a facility with a critical care unit. Adequate wound management is essential to minimize residual deformity. (Source: Journal of Indian Association of Pediatric Surgeons)

Transcutaneous electrical nerve stimulation in management of neurogenic bladder secondary to spina bifida
Conclusions: The application of TENS in NB secondary to SB is effective and its application led to improvement in symptoms, decrease in the wet episodes/day, maximum detrusor pressure, instability, bladder compliance, and capacity. TENS therapy in combination with anticholinergic agents had a better outcome as compared to monotherapy with either of the two modalities. Black ovary: Our experience with oophoropexy in all cases of pediatric ovarian torsion and review of relevant literature
Conclusion: Detorsion and oophoropexy should be the procedure of choice in pediatric patients with ovarian torsion. The gross appearance of the ovary after detorsion should not be the sole determinant for oophorectomy. (Source: Journal of Indian Association of Pediatric Surgeons)

Evaluation of the outcome of pyeloplasty in children with poorly functioning kidneys due to unilateral ureteropelvic junction obstruction
Conclusion: Upfront pyeloplasty should be the first option in children with poorly functioning kidneys as it has a favorable outcome in almost all the cases with a very low incidence of complications. The degree of improvement in SRF can be predicted by the nephrostomy output and improvement in PT on US. (Source: Journal of Indian Association of Pediatric Surgeons)

Fibromatosis colli: About 26 cases
Conclusions: Rare condition of the newborn and infant for which the diagnosis is clinical and the confirmation is based on ultrasound. The management is simple and based on surveillance. The evolution is most often toward spontaneous regression. (Source: Journal of Indian Association of Pediatric Surgeons)

Probiotics as prophylaxis for postoperative infections of under-five children following gastrointestinal surgery
Conclusion: Use of probiotics along with traditional gut preparation as prophylaxis for postoperative infection in children showed no added benefit in comparison to the use of traditional gut preparation only. (Source: Journal of Indian Association of Pediatric Surgeons)
